Iconic Landmarks and Waterfront Highlights
The first stop is the Ferry Building, an unmistakable Auckland icon since 1912. Its Edwardian Baroque façade is instantly photogenic, and it’s fascinating to hear how it once served as a hub for maritime traffic. From here, the tour transitions smoothly to Viaduct Harbour, which perfectly captures Auckland’s sailing heritage. We loved the way the marina’s modern skyline frames the water, creating an energetic, stylish scene.
Driving through Wynyard Quarter, we saw this buzzing waterfront district filled with trendy restaurants and public spaces. The mix of modern architecture and harbourside vibe shows a city that’s both innovative and welcoming.
A brief visit to Westhaven Marina — the largest recreational marina in the Southern Hemisphere — reveals Auckland’s deep connection to boating and leisure. With more than 2,000 boats, it’s a lively spot that offers a glimpse into the city’s nautical lifestyle.
Crossing the Auckland Harbour Bridge is an experience in itself, providing sweeping views of Waitematā Harbour and the city skyline. This famous structure is more than just a bridge; it’s a symbol of Auckland’s connection to the North Shore and a perfect photo opportunity.
Discovering the Nautical and Seaside Charms
The journey continues through Devonport, a charming seaside village with heritage homes and boutique cafés. It’s a peaceful, scenic area that suggests Auckland’s relaxed lifestyle—something you’ll notice throughout this tour. We appreciated the brief glimpse, which hints at the city’s slower, more authentic pace.
Next, we visit North Head Historic Reserve, where military tunnels and fortifications from the 1800s tell stories of Auckland’s defensive history. The vantage point here offers panoramic views of Rangitoto Island and the harbour—a highlight for scenic lovers and history buffs alike.

Natural Wonders and Cultural Sites
The next stop is Mount Eden, the highest natural point in Auckland. From here, you’ll enjoy 360-degree views across the city, with the distinctive volcanic crater adding a dramatic natural feature. It’s an impressive spot that combines natural beauty with urban views, giving a sense of Auckland’s volcanic origins.
The Auckland Museum, located within the Domain, allows travelers to connect with New Zealand’s history and heritage. The architecture alone is notable, but the exhibits offer a compelling window into the country’s past.
K Road (Karangahape Road) is Auckland’s creative hub, alive with arts, independent shops, and eclectic eateries. It’s a lively, diverse street that reflects the city’s modern, inclusive spirit. Many reviews comment on its vibrant atmosphere and unique character.
For a touch of tranquility, the Parnell Rose Gardens showcase thousands of brightly colored roses—perfect for a leisurely stroll and some beautiful photos.
Coastal Drives and Scenic Lookouts
The tour then takes you along Tamaki Drive, passing Mission Bay with its golden sands and Rangitoto Island in the distance. It’s a classic Auckland scene—beach, pohutukawa trees, and a relaxed seaside atmosphere.
Finally, at Achilles Point, enjoy spectacular views over the Hauraki Gulf, famous for its photo-worthy vistas and historical significance related to HMS Achilles. This spot is ideal for snapping memorable photos and absorbing the beauty of Auckland’s coast.
